siObjectIdentifierType

説明

DataRepository.GetIdentifier のオブジェクトID の指定可能なタイプの列挙です。

C#構文

siObjectIdentifierType.siObjectIdentifier                                   // 0

siObjectIdentifierType.siModelIdentifier                                    // 1

siObjectIdentifierType.siObjectGUID                                         // 2

siObjectIdentifierType.siObjectCLSID                                        // 3

siObjectIdentifierType.siSpdlFile                                           // 4

コンスタント 詳細
siObjectIdentifier 0 オブジェクトの識別子。これは数値で、システム内のオブジェクトを一意に識別します。
siModelIdentifier 1 オブジェクトを含むモデルの識別子。Scene_Root 以下の各オブジェクトはモデルの一部です。このコマンドは、そのオブジェクトが属するモデルを戻します。そのオブジェクトがモデルの一部でない場合は -1 を 戻します。
siObjectGUID 2 オブジェクトの GUID。シーン内のオブジェクトを一意に識別する GUID です。
siObjectCLSID 3 クラスの CLSID。

このオブジェクトがインスタンスであるクラスを一意に識別するGUID です。
siSpdlFile 4 オブジェクトに関連付けられている SPDL ファイル。Softimage オブジェクトの中には SPDL ファイルを持たないものもあります。

適用対象

DataRepository.GetIdentifier